Here we are introducing our new worksheet. This worksheet is especially designed for kindergarten. In this worksheet, kids will know more about the outside world—that everything in this world has different sizes.
Even some of the same things have different sizes. With the help of this worksheet, they will be able to differentiate between things of different sizes. In this worksheet, the same thing is in two sizes.
For example, elephants are given in both small and big sizes so that kids can differentiate easily and without any difficulties. In this activity, they need to compare the size and then tick the correct answer to the question that is asked.
